The Federal High Court sitting in Abuja on Monday nullified the N800 billion 2024 budget signed into law by the Rivers State Governor, Similanayi Fubara.
In December, the governor presented a N800 billion 2024 Appropriation Bill to a group of the state House of Assembly, which included four lawmakers.
Fubara signed the budget into law after lawmakers approved it.
The Rivers Assembly fractured as 27 legislators loyal to ex-governor Nyesom Wike attempted to impeach Fubara.
The presiding judge, James Omotosho, ruled that all actions taken by the four legislators were invalid.
The court also recognized Martin Amaewhule as the state assembly’s speaker.
